Am I eligible to be a Referral Partner?
If you are an established local or national service provider for physical businesses in the United States (e.g., MSPs, AV/digital signage installers, POS consultants/resellers), you are likely eligible. You must be able to provide a valid IRS Form W-9.
How do I sign up?
To join the Referral Partner Program and for us to determine final eligibility, please submit a help request through this portal indicating your interest. Please provide your corporate website and any other relevant info (e.g., client base size, geographic location) to help us determine eligibility.
If you are eligible, you will be asked to submit IRS Form W-9 to us.
How much do I earn, and when?
- Up to $300:
- $200 after the referred location has completed 3 full paid billing cycles and remains active (measured from the first successful payment date)
- $100 after the referred location has completed 12 full paid billing cycles and remains active (measured from the first successful payment date)
How do I track businesses that I have referred?
After joining the Program, we will provide a form through which you can submit locations that you have referred to the Stella program.
Referred businesses will order directly through our website. We do not require them to submit a referral code; we will reconcile the locations you submit against our signups. Only one partner may be credited per location.
What is the protection window?
- Deal registration protection window: 120 days.
- Post-signup grace period: 14 days. For late referrals submitted after customer signup, measured from the first successful payment timestamp, and only if the location is not already attributed to another partner.
What is an eligible business?
Eligible businesses are physical stores and restaurants in the United States that are located in commercial space and open to the public (walk-in or public foot traffic). Each separate, physical location of a chain counts as a separate eligible business.
Ineligible businesses include, but are not limited to:
- Office spaces
- Ineligible sectors (e.g., spas, service-oriented businesses including hair salons, adult-themed stores)
- Locations outside the contiguous United States
- Any other business, at our sole discretion, that we choose not to ship Stella to (including for compliance, safety, or operational reasons)
What is the definition of "remaining active" with Stella?
- The business must remain in good standing with respect to payments for Stella (not more than 14 days past due)
- The business must keep Stella in a customer-facing area during normal operating hours (allowing for temporary relocation, maintenance, renovations, and power/internet outages)
- Stella must remain powered on and connected aside from scheduled outages and reasonable interruptions
We verify activity via remote device health and uptime telemetry.
